How are `XeO_(3)` and `XeOF_(4)` prepared ?

Text Solution

Verified by Experts

Preparation of `XeO_(3)`. By complete hydrolysis of `XeF_(6)`.
`XeF_(6) +3H_(2)O to XeO_(3)+6HF`.
Preparation of `XeOF_(4)`. By partial hydrolysis of `XeF_(6)`.
`XeF_(6) +H_(2)O to XeOF_(4)+2HF`.
